Victory Over Keys Takes Pittsburgh to 11-3
|
The Pittsburgh Monongahelas downed the Kansas City Keys, 7-4, at Polo Grounds 1923. Manuel Aguirre led the way, going 1-for-3 for Pittsburgh. Josh Phillips got the win, improving to 1-2. He held the Keys to 2 runs on 5 hits over 6.2 innings, while striking out 8 and walking 1. Antonio Salcido closed it out for his 6th save.
Nick McNalley, the slick-fielding third baseman , had a direct impact on the outcome. McNalley contributed a run-scoring single in the top of the sixth inning to put Pittsburgh up, 3-2.
"We were able to get some things going offensively," said Aguirre.
The Monongahelas, now 11-3, have played some good baseball in the early going.
